Iranian and Pakistani Foreign Ministers Engage in Diplomatic Talks on Regional Stability
In a significant move towards enhancing regional cooperation, the foreign ministers of Iran and Pakistan convened for extensive diplomatic discussions focused on current geopolitical developments. Both leaders emphasized the importance of strengthening bilateral ties to promote peace and security across shared borders. Key topics included counterterrorism efforts, trade facilitation, and joint infrastructure projects aimed at fostering economic stability. The meeting highlighted a mutual commitment to addressing emerging challenges through constructive dialogue and collaboration.
During the talks, several strategic priorities were outlined:
- Enhancing border security coordination to curb illicit activities.
- Expanding economic partnerships in energy and transportation sectors.
- Promoting cultural and educational exchanges to deepen mutual understanding.
- Collaborating on regional peace initiatives with neighboring countries.

Focus on Enhancing Bilateral Cooperation to Address Security Challenges
During the recent dialogue, both foreign ministers underscored the critical need to strengthen cooperation frameworks aimed at tackling shared security threats. Emphasis was placed on enhancing intelligence sharing and coordinated border management to effectively counter terrorism and cross-border criminal activities. The discussions highlighted a mutual commitment to fostering stability in the region through collaborative efforts that leverage the strengths of both nations.
Key collaborative priorities include:
- Joint counterterrorism initiatives to disrupt extremist networks.
- Enhanced maritime security in the Arabian Sea to secure trade routes.
- Improved cyber-security cooperation to address emerging digital threats.
A preliminary roadmap was proposed, laying out phased action points to institutionalize these efforts and ensure sustainable impact.
